  • This tour is your chance to go on a unique adventure along the stunning South Coast of Iceland. From Reykjavik, visit Vatnajokull National Park home to the largest glacier in Iceland, with stops at all the highlights of the South Coast. Experience the power of Skogafoss and Seljalandsfoss waterfalls, stroll along the black sand beach of Reynisfjara and then head to the mesmerizing Jokulsarlon Glacier Lagoon and admire the surrounding wonder world of ice.
